Attorneys for Asbestos Exposure

From the 1930s until the 1970s, asbestos was widely employed in building materials. It was used in pipe insulation and fireproofing, as well as cements, plasters and breaks, and much more. The exposure to this mineral can trigger a number of serious medical conditions like mesothelioma, and other respiratory illnesses.

A reputable New York mesothelioma lawyer can help victims seek compensation from the companies responsible for their exposure. It is important to choose the right attorney when filing this type of claim.

Look for a Specialist

Asbest fibers are inhaled when they are extracted and processed. This can lead to asbestosis, lung cancer and mesothelioma. People who handle asbestos directly are more at risk, however anyone can breathe asbestos. This type of exposure, called secondary exposure is a risk to anyone who comes in contact with the worker's contaminated clothes or equipment. This is the case for relatives who wash the uniform of the worker and anyone who lives in the same household. This can happen on ships and bases of military where the workers wear the exact identical uniform for a long period of time.

Asbestos can be a problem for people who work in shipyards, construction and mills and also in mining, insulation and other industries. This was especially true in the United States between the 1950s and 1990s. Workers were exposed to it when old structures were destroyed or remodeled and also when construction materials were damaged. Even the present day, demolition and renovation in older buildings can release asbestos into the air.

It is possible to take an extended period of time between exposure to asbestos before the onset of mesothelioma and other symptoms. It is important to consult a physician when you've been exposed to asbestos, or suspect that you are suffering from any of the ailments that are associated with asbestos.

Your doctor will examine your lungs and ask about any asbestos-related work history. If they suspect that you suffer from an asbestos-related condition, they will likely refer you to a specialist for additional tests. Chest X-rays CT scans and pulmonary function tests can all detect asbestos-related diseases but they don't always show up on these tests.

These diseases can affect the lungs, the heart and abdomen. It is extremely rare that mesothelioma develops in the brain.

Some experts believe that the best method to protect yourself from asbestos exposure is to stay clear of all types of dust and never smoke or work in an industry that could use asbestos. Other experts say that this is impossible and that individuals should be examined often for signs of asbestos-related ailments.

Report Your Suspicion to Your Employer

Asbestos is a fibrous substance utilized in a variety of industrial processes due to its resistance to heat as well as its flexibility and strength. However, asbestos can also cause various serious health issues, including mesothelioma and lung cancer. These conditions can be painful, debilitating and even fatal. Anyone who has been exposed to asbestos could be entitled to compensation. A successful lawsuit could pay for medical expenses, lost wages, home care costs, and much more.

Workers who have come into contact with asbestos should be aware of any signs of illness. This is particularly important for construction workers who are frequently exposed to asbestos when renovating old buildings. These buildings were constructed before asbestos was recognized to be a carcinogen and could contain dangerous levels of the substance.

Exposure to asbestos can trigger many different illnesses, and the symptoms of these ailments typically do not appear for about 25 to 50 years after the exposure. Therefore, people who have been exposed to asbestos settlement should be scheduled for regular health check-ups with a doctor. This is the best way to prevent the development of asbestos-related illnesses or to recognize any early warning symptoms.

Certain people are more at risk of exposure to asbestos than others. For instance, Navy veterans may have been exposed to the material during their time on ships and in other military facilities. Asbestos was also discovered in those who work with shipyards as well as heating systems, construction or automotive industries.

There are numerous organizations that establish laws and regulations for employers to adhere to when it comes asbestos in the workplace. If you suspect that your employer isn't following these standards, call the Occupational Safety and Health Administration for more information or to request an inspection.

Some veterans who served in the United States Armed Forces are also qualified for disability compensation. Veterans who are eligible can file claims for benefits due to asbestos exposure during their time in the VA.

Claim Your Claim

Your attorney will gather your health and employment records to establish a timeline for your asbestos exposure. Then, they will build your case by assembling evidence that proves that you were exposed and that exposure led to harm. The complaint will be sent to every defendant and they will have 30 days in which to respond. The defendants typically deny responsibility and may try to pin blame on another person. You need a seasoned team of attorneys to handle these claims.

Once your attorney has all the necessary documentation they will file your asbestos case. They will file it in the state court system that is most appropriate for your situation. During this time, attorneys will collect evidence and conduct discovery, where they exchange information about the case with the opposing side. They will also argue your case in trial if it is decided to go to trial. However, most cases resolve through an asbestos settlement.

Asbestos litigation is distinct from other personal injury cases that's why it's important to hire mesothelioma experts. They have access to a database that informs patients what specific asbestos-related products they used during their work. This helps patients to determine the asbestos products at fault for their exposure.

They also know which companies are accountable for your exposure. This includes the makers of asbestos-containing products that you handled, and the owners of buildings containing asbestos. They can also file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ds if you were exposed to more than one company's asbestos lawyer-contaminated products.

If you or someone you love have been diagnosed with mesothelioma, lung cancer or any other asbestos-related illness, it is important to act fast. There is a time limit to file a claim for asbestos. The laws differ from jurisdiction to jurisdiction.
